It has delivered flawless service, and averages 26 mpg on 87 octane in a semi-rural environment. UPDATE: I have owned my 2021 Passport EX-L for nearly 2 years and driven it 19,000 miles. Overall MPG is 23 on recommended unleaded, mostly rural roads It's a big vehicle, but not unwieldy, as it fits into normal parking places. Cargo space behind the rear seats provides room for 4 sets of golf clubs - and then some. Push-button transmission takes some getting used to but works great. All the tech bells and whistles come with it, and the interface is intuitive. Ride is exceptional, and it is very quiet. The engine in Normal mode is highly responsive, throwing me back in the seat when I tromped on the gas at 50mph. The front seats are super-comfortable rear seats have some adjustability and flip down with the touch of a button. The Passport EX-L has everything we wanted and more in terms of options.
